An album that's trying to move forward and ultimately relieved things are ending, Tell Me That It's Over may not find Wallows any luckier at love, but they're a little older, a little wiser, just as catchy, and more sonically adventurous.

Wallows didn’t really impress me with their first album and their 2018 EP, but this record has a lot of sunny and colorful textures and interesting musical ideas. They still have some ways to go, but I think they’ve proved they aren’t just another dime a dozen indie rock band and they have potential to make something really cool. Wallows is an indie-pop band that has had a very solid fanbase during 5 years, their second release is a mixed bag, a pretty generic one yet a pretty creative at the same time. The album opens with a pretty boring track called "Hard To Believe", no offense to any wallows fans. I Don't Want To Talk is a pretty ok song, and the most popular song from here.
